Abstract
Electrooptic light modulators are one of key elements to materialize future photonic systems for info-communication and instrumentation technologies. A number of possible MWP applications have been proposed and investigated, while a few practical devices have been implemented. With the recent growing interest in this area, we can expect rapid development in the utilization of lightwave technologies in microwave engineering, exploiting the potentiality in microwave and lightwave interactions through electrooptic effects.
